The Boondocks (band):

The Boondocks is an Estonian non-mainstream musical gang shaped in 2012 in Pärnu, Estonia. The band comprises Villem Sarapuu (guitar/vocals), Hendrik Tamberg (bass/backing vocals), Romet Mägar (guitar), and Karl Kevad (drums/backing vocals). They have delivered four collections: USB (2014), Thriller (2016), How to Build a Love Bomb (2018) and Soup Can Pop Band (2021).
